On an evening in mid-April, Red Bull Arena in Harrison, N.J., provided the setting for a career-best performance from Sporting Kansas City goalkeeper Tim Melia. He stopped six shots, one of them a penalty kick off the foot of the league’s top scorer, serving as the catalyst for a 2-0 victory.
Some 167 days later, the result remains Sporting Kansas City’s most recent road triumph.
The relevance: With only four games left in its MLS regular season, the team’s playoff hopes will almost almost certainly be decided outside of Children’s Mercy Park.
Sporting KC occupies the sixth and final playoff spot in the Western Conference.
